Inspector General Investigated For Muzzling Inconvenient Science
SOURCE: SLASHDOT • 2011-09-17
Layzej writes Federal biologist Charles Monnett was placed on administrative leave July 18 pending final results of an inspector general's investigation into integrity issues. The investigation originally focused on a 2006 note published in Polar Biology based on a unique observation of four dead polar bears.
